Why Your AC Compressor May Stop Working
The compressor circulates refrigerant through your air conditioning system. Without it, the system cannot remove heat from your home.Common causes include:
- Electrical component failure
- Failed start capacitor
- Burned contactor
- Low refrigerant levels
- Refrigerant leaks
- Dirty condenser coils
- Overheating from restricted airflow
- Faulty thermostat
- Damaged wiring
- Tripped circuit breaker
Warning Signs Your Compressor Needs Professional Attention
Not every cooling issue means the compressor has failed, but several symptoms deserve immediate inspection.Watch for these signs
- AC runs but doesn't cool
- Outdoor unit hums without starting
- Loud clicking or buzzing sounds
- Frequent breaker trips
- Warm air from supply vents
- Short cycling
- Frozen refrigerant lines
- Outdoor fan running while the compressor stays off
Step-by-Step Professional Diagnosis
A thorough inspection identifies the real issue instead of replacing unnecessary parts.Inspection Process
- Test thermostat operation.
- Check electrical voltage.
- Inspect capacitor and contactor.
- Measure refrigerant pressure.
- Examine compressor windings.
- Test compressor startup amperage.
- Inspect condenser coil condition.
- Evaluate airflow throughout the system.
Can an AC Compressor Be Repaired?
In many situations, yes.Minor electrical failures often involve replacing components such as capacitors, relays, or contactors. Refrigerant leaks can sometimes be repaired before compressor damage occurs. However, if the compressor motor has seized or internal mechanical components fail, replacement may be the better long-term investment.

Common Mistakes Homeowners Should Avoid
Many compressor failures become worse because of delayed maintenance or incorrect troubleshooting.Avoid these mistakes
- Continuously resetting the breaker
- Ignoring strange noises
- Running the system with frozen coils
- Delaying refrigerant leak repairs
- Replacing parts without proper testing
- Skipping annual HVAC maintenance
- Blocking airflow around the outdoor condenser
Expert Tips to Prevent Future Compressor Problems
Routine maintenance is the best defense against unexpected compressor failure.Helpful maintenance practices
Replace air filters regularly
Dirty filters restrict airflow and increase system strain.Keep the outdoor unit clean
Leaves, grass, and debris reduce condenser efficiency.Schedule annual tune-ups
Professional inspections identify worn components before they fail.Monitor refrigerant levels
Proper refrigerant charge helps protect compressor performance.Install a programmable thermostat

Frequently Asked Questions
Can a bad capacitor make the compressor stop working?
Yes. A failed capacitor is one of the most common reasons an AC compressor won't start.How do I know if my compressor is completely failed?
Testing electrical resistance, voltage, and refrigerant pressures is the most accurate way to confirm compressor failure.Is compressor replacement always necessary?
No. Many cooling problems involve electrical components rather than the compressor itself.Why does my AC keep tripping the breaker?
A failing compressor, electrical short, damaged capacitor, or overloaded circuit may be responsible.How long does compressor repair usually take?
Simple electrical repairs may be completed within a few hours, while compressor replacement typically requires additional time depending on equipment availability.Should I keep running my AC if it isn't cooling?
